Importance of Regular Home AC Service
Regular maintenance is crucial for the longevity of your home AC unit. By scheduling service visits on a consistent basis, you can ensure that your system is running efficiently and effectively. Neglecting regular service can lead to costly repairs down the line and even shorten the lifespan of your AC unit.
Benefits of Scheduled Service Visits
- Improved Energy Efficiency: Regular maintenance helps your AC unit run more efficiently, reducing energy consumption and lowering utility bills.
- Enhanced Air Quality: Cleaning and replacing filters during service visits can improve the air quality in your home by reducing dust, pollen, and other allergens.
- Prevent Breakdowns: Regular inspections can catch small issues before they become major problems, preventing unexpected breakdowns.
Common Issues Prevented with Regular Servicing
- Refrigerant Leaks: Checking and refilling refrigerant levels during service visits can prevent leaks that can lead to system malfunctions.
- Clogged Air Filters: Regularly cleaning or replacing air filters can prevent airflow issues and strain on the system.
- Thermostat Problems: Calibration and adjustment of the thermostat during service visits can ensure accurate temperature control.

Signs Your AC Needs Servicing
Regular maintenance of your AC unit is crucial to ensure it functions efficiently and lasts longer. Ignoring signs that indicate your AC needs servicing can lead to costly repairs or even a complete breakdown.
Unusual Sounds
One common sign that your AC unit needs servicing is unusual sounds coming from the system. These sounds can include banging, squealing, or grinding noises, which may indicate issues with the motor, fan blades, or other components.
Strange Smells
If you notice unusual odors coming from your AC unit, such as musty or burning smells, it could be a sign of mold or electrical problems. Ignoring these smells can lead to poor indoor air quality and potential health hazards.
Poor Performance
Decreased cooling efficiency, uneven cooling in different rooms, or frequent cycling on and off are all signs of poor AC performance. These issues can result from clogged filters, refrigerant leaks, or faulty components that require professional attention.
Importance of Prompt Action
It is essential not to ignore these warning signs and to address them promptly. Delaying servicing can lead to more extensive damage to your AC unit and higher repair costs in the long run. Regular maintenance can help prevent major issues and prolong the lifespan of your system.
Professional Service vs
. DIY Fixes
While some minor AC issues can be resolved with DIY fixes like changing filters or cleaning vents, more complex problems require professional service. Attempting to repair or service your AC unit without the necessary expertise can cause further damage and void warranties.
DIY Maintenance Tips for Home AC Units

Performing regular maintenance on your home AC unit is essential to ensure it runs efficiently and lasts longer. Here are some simple tips for DIY maintenance that you can do to keep your AC unit in good condition:
Cleaning or Replacing Filters
One of the most important maintenance tasks for your AC unit is cleaning or replacing the air filters regularly. Clogged or dirty filters can restrict airflow, reducing the efficiency of your unit and causing it to work harder. Follow these steps to clean or replace your filters:
- Turn off your AC unit before starting any maintenance.
- Locate the air filters in your unit. They are usually found behind the return air grille or within the air handler unit.
- If the filters are washable, remove them and gently wash with mild soap and water. Allow them to dry completely before reinstalling.
- If the filters are disposable, replace them with new ones according to the manufacturer's instructions.
- Regularly check and clean or replace filters every 1-3 months, depending on usage.
Improving AC Efficiency Through Regular Cleaning
In addition to cleaning or replacing filters, regular cleaning of the AC unit's coils, fins, and vents can improve its efficiency. Dust and debris buildup can hinder airflow and reduce cooling capacity. Here are some tips for cleaning your AC unit:
- Use a vacuum cleaner with a soft brush attachment to clean the evaporator and condenser coils.
- Gently straighten bent fins with a fin comb to ensure proper airflow.
- Clear debris and obstructions around the outdoor unit to allow for adequate airflow.
- Trim vegetation and remove any obstacles that may obstruct airflow to the unit.

FAQ Compilation
How often should I schedule a service for my home AC unit?
You should ideally schedule a service for your home AC unit at least once a year to ensure it functions optimally.
What are some common signs that indicate my AC unit needs professional attention?
Unusual sounds, foul odors, or inconsistent cooling are common signs that your AC unit requires servicing by a professional.
Can I perform DIY maintenance on my AC unit?
While simple tasks like cleaning or replacing filters can be done by homeowners, more complex issues should be handled by professionals.
